Average Childcare Workers Salary in East Arkansas nonmetropolitan area

Childcare Workers in the East Arkansas nonmetropolitan area earn an average annual salary of $26,200. This figure falls below the national average of $32,190, indicating a localized compensation structure influenced by regional economic factors and the specific demand within this nonmetropolitan setting. East Arkansas nonmetropolitan area has 2.1x the national concentration of Childcare Workers jobs — a major employment hub for this role. Job seekers will find significantly more opportunities here than in most other areas.

The Location Quotient of 2.13 for Childcare Workers in East Arkansas is notably high, indicating that this profession is more than twice as concentrated in this region compared to the national average. This suggests a strong local demand and a specialized labor market where Childcare Workers are a significant component of the workforce.

Methodology: Salary data is derived from the Bureau of Labor Statistics (BLS) OEWS 2024 release. Figures represent gross pay before taxes. Analysis includes 490 employees in the East Arkansas nonmetropolitan area area with a job density of 7.188 per 1,000 jobs. Cost of Living data is estimated based on state and metro averages.
